Indonesian[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Dutch record, from French record, from Old French record, from recorder.

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): [ˈrɛkɔr]
  • Hyphenation: rè‧kor

Noun[edit]

rèkor (first-person possessive rekorku, second-person possessive rekormu, third-person possessive rekornya)

  1. record: the most extreme known value of some variable, particularly that of an achievement in competitive events.

Alternative forms[edit]

  • rékod (Brunei, Malaysia, Singapore)
